Luxury housing, cars and parking spaces: 21-year-old son of Volyn tax official Poberezhnyi became owner of real estate worth 7 million hryvnias
A 21-year-old student has become the owner of five real estate properties in Lviv and Lutsk over the past year. Their value may reach 7 million hryvnias. The young man is the son of Volyn tax official Volodymyr Poberezhnyi, who is named in a criminal case involving a tax evasion scheme.
Slidstvo.Info journalists also found apartments, non-residential premises, parking spaces, and a car registered to Poberezhnyi’s wife and mother. Overall, his family and closest relatives have acquired assets in recent years that may be worth more than 20 million hryvnias.
More details on the assets of the Volyn tax official’s family are in a new investigation by Yana Korniychuk.
